This paper considers the beta‐binomial convolution model for the analysis of 2×2 tables with missing cell counts. We discuss maximum‐likelihood (ML) parameter estimation using the expectation–maximization algorithm and study information loss relative to complete data estimators. We also examine bias of the ML estimators of the beta‐binomial convolution. The results are illustrated by two example applications.
